The ethical Dilemmas Faced by Auditors

As an integral part of any organization's financial health and regulatory compliance, the role of auditors has change into more and more advanced over time. Not solely do they need to supply an independent evaluation of monetary statements and inside controls, but in addition they have to navigate a large number of ethical dilemmas that may come up in the method. In this text, we'll delve into the ethical dilemmas confronted by auditors and discover a number of the ways by which they are often resolved.

One of many most important moral dilemmas confronted by auditors is the conflict between objectivity and professionalism. On one hand, auditors are expected to offer an unbiased and independent evaluation of an organization's monetary statements. Then again, they may be subject to strain from their employers or purchasers to produce results that are extra favorable to the organization. This will create a tension between the auditor's professional obligations and their private or organizational loyalties.

Another moral dilemma confronted by auditors is the problem of reporting fraud. When an auditor discovers evidence of fraud, they're confronted with a troublesome resolution: whether to report the problem or ignore it in order to maintain their professional relationship with the organization. This can be notably challenging in cases where the auditor believes that reporting the fraud may have severe penalties for the organization, its workers, or its stakeholders.

Auditors are additionally confronted with the difficulty of auditor independence. As an illustration, an auditor's family member could also be employed by the shopper, or the auditor may have a private curiosity in the organization. In such circumstances, the auditor should ensure that their independence is just not compromised and that they'll present an unbiased and goal evaluation of the organization's monetary statements.

In addition to these dilemmas, auditors are also faced with the problem of confidentiality and information protection. As auditors have entry to sensitive and confidential information, they should be certain that they maintain the confidentiality of this information. This includes preventing the unauthorized disclosure of sensitive knowledge and guaranteeing that they comply with relevant data protection laws.

Resolving these ethical dilemmas requires auditors to exercise skilled skepticism, to maintain their independence, and to adhere to the best standards of objectivity and integrity. This can involve in search of guidance from skilled bodies, such because the International Federation of Accountants (IFAC), or consulting with peers and mentors.

Ultimately, the function of auditors just isn't solely to detect and report material errors and irregularities but also to supply assurance that a corporation's financial statements are introduced fairly and precisely. To attain this, auditors should navigate the complex panorama of moral dilemmas and make choices which might be guided by their professional obligations and a commitment to integrity.

By being aware of these moral dilemmas and the steps that can be taken to resolve them, auditors can present the highest degree of assurance and contribute to maintaining public belief and confidence in the monetary markets.
